Transaction 22e3044804a6d7586dd06a2f2c70494bb0c65750c6bafd55258156d8780e0708
1 Input
1 Output
-
22e3044804a6d7586dd06a2f2c70494bb0c65750c6bafd55258156d8780e0708:0
- value
- 15162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c865c11f6f40ddf4f8e615fd054aaa32b7e9b0b5 OP_EQUAL
- address
- 3KxcxvonHa5qBqdra39yt5NK49gLeHQREK